[Clyde Pangborn and Hugh Herndon with "Miss Veedol"]
Photographic postcard of Clyde Pangborn (right) and Hugh Herndon (left) standing in front of "Miss Veedol," a Bellanca Skyrocket CH-400 aircraft (tail number NR796W), after the airplane's belly-landing in Wenatchee, Washington, October 8, 1931.Inscription: "Trans Pacific Flyers at the Bon Marche. Oct. 8, 1931."

[Howard Hughes, associates, and Lockheed Super Electra]
Photographic postcard of Howard Hughes, his flight crew and associates, and his Lockheed Model 14-N2 Super Electra aircraft (tail number NX 18973) at Floyd Bennett Field, New York, circa July 1938. [Clyde Pangborn and Ralph Reed with Curtiss JN-4D Jenny]
Photographic postcard of Clyde Pangborn (left) and Ralph Reed (right) standing in front of a Curtiss JN-4D Jenny aircraft, Saint Maries, Idaho, September 1919. Inscription: "St Maries. Ida." Inscription on verso: "Taken Sep. 1919, Clyde E. Pangborn and R. A. Reed, [address in Saint Maries, Idaho]."
